An independent used and rare bookseller in operation for nearly 15 years, we opened our first brick and mortar storefront in December of 2008 in our hometown of Webster, NY. Owner Jonathan Smalter is a member of the ABAA, and former vice president of the Independent Online Booksellers Association (IOBA). He is also a 2011 graduate of the Colorado Antiquarian Book Seminar (CABS). He has over twenty years of experience in the book trade.
